Hublot and Arturo Fuente, renowned for its premium cigars, have had a fruitful partnership since 2012. Collectively, they’ve launched plenty of watch editions and supported charitable initiatives throughout the Dominican Republic by way of the Fuente Family Foundation. At the moment, on the Arturo Fuente Cigar Manufacturing unit, Hublot unveiled its latest collaborative piece, the Hublot Conventional Fusion Chronograph Arturo Fuente King Gold, which celebrates the twenty fifth anniversary of OpusX, a cigar thought-about to be certainly one of many most attention-grabbing on the earth. This sixth Hublot and Arturo Fuente explicit model watch is impressed by Carlito Fuente, creator of the Fuente Fuente OpusX mannequin. It is designed with intricate tobacco-themed accents, subtly reflecting the rich, aroma-filled passion of the Fuente legacy.
The model new Hublot Conventional Fusion Chronograph Arturo Fuente is launched in a 42mm x 11.9mm case crafted from 18K King Gold, a platinum-enriched gold alloy developed by Hublot. True to the design language of the Conventional Fusion Chronograph, the case and bezel operate an interplay of satin-finished and polished surfaces. The lateral protectors, the rectangular chronograph pushers, the fluted crown, and the signature screws ship a well-recognized aesthetic. Together with a novel contact to this explicit model, the bezel is adorned with laser-engraved tobacco leaves.
The gradient inexperienced dial of the Hublot Conventional Fusion Chronograph Arturo Fuente encompasses a sunray-patterned finish. Positioned at 3 and 9 o’clock are two subdials – one for the working seconds and the alternative for chronograph minutes – each with a black centre, encircled by golden outer rings and complemented by small gold-toned palms.
The working seconds subdial hosts the anniversary model of the OpusX emblem in gold and inexperienced, set in direction of a black background. Faceted hour and minute palms align with the utilized, faceted indices, whereas the chronograph’s central seconds hand bears Hublot’s distinctive counterweight. A date aperture is located at 6 o’clock, and the minutes/seconds observe alongside the dial’s edge contrasts with its darker half created by the fumé influence, together with depth to the design.
Flip the watch to reveal its secure satin-finished and microblasted caseback, crafted from 18K King Gold. Secured by six signature screws, the caseback choices an engraved and lacquered design commemorating the twenty fifth Anniversary of OpusX. The artwork work consists of Carlito Fuente’s signature on the bottom, and the image is topped by a Panama hat – a fragile tribute. The model new Hublot Conventional Fusion Chronograph Arturo Fuente is powered by the HUB1153 self-winding chronograph calibre (ETA 2892 A2 base), which operates at 28,800 vibrations/hour and offers 48 hours of vitality reserve.
The watch is paired with a inexperienced alligator leather-based strap, backed with black rubber for added comfort, and secured by a folding clasp. This Conventional Fusion Chronograph timepiece is a restricted model of fifty, and the price is CHF 36,900 or EUR 42,200.
